South Korea Interventional Cardiology Devices Market Size, Share, Trends and Forecast by Product, End User, and Region, 2026-2034
The South Korea interventional cardiology devices market size reached USD 497.3 Million in 2025. Looking forward, IMARC Group expects the market to reach USD 852.7 Million by 2034, exhibiting a growth rate (CAGR) of 5.99% during 2026-2034. South Korea is experiencing a rise in cardiovascular diseases like coronary heart disease, stroke, and hypertension. Moreover, dramatic shift towards minimally invasive cardiac interventions, led primarily by developments in device miniaturization, flexibility, and material make-up is supporting the market growth. Additionally, the improved healthcare infrastructure and proactive government support are expanding the South Korea interventional cardiology devices market share.
SOUTH KOREA INTERVENTIONAL CARDIOLOGY DEVICES MARKET TRENDS:
Increasing Incidence of Cardiovascular Disease and Aging Population
South Korea is also experiencing a rise in cardiovascular diseases like coronary heart disease, stroke, and hypertension. All these are mostly caused by lifestyle changes like high intakes of processed foods, lack of physical activity, smoking, and stress. To add to this, the nation's fast-growing aging population is exacerbating the problem, as the elderly are more likely to be affected by heart ailments. According to recent statistics from the Ministry of the Interior and Safety, the population of individuals aged 65 and above is 10.24 million, representing 20% of South Korea's total population of 51 million. Therefore, the need for interventional cardiology interventions like angioplasty and stenting rising among the geriatric population. These treatments are almost entirely dependent on devices like balloon catheters, guidewires, and drug-eluting stents. Hospitals and clinics are increasingly spending money on these technologies to meet the mounting patient load. As such, the patient base and related requirement for efficient, non-invasive forms of treatment are taking center stage in propelling the South Korea interventional cardiology devices market growth.
Technological Advancements and Shift Toward Minimally Invasive Procedures
Technological improvement is a key driver revolutionizing interventional cardiology in South Korea. There has been a dramatic shift towards minimally invasive cardiac interventions, led primarily by developments in device miniaturization, flexibility, and material make-up. More advanced-generation stents, image-guided catheters, and pressure-sensing guidewires are enhancing the accuracy and success rate of interventions. Such technologies are allowing cardiologists to treat complex lesions with increased safety, reduced procedure time, and faster patient recovery. Minimally invasive procedures are also becoming popular among patients because of shorter hospital stays, minimal post-operative pain, and lower rates of complications. Hospitals and specialty clinics are now more commonly provided with sophisticated laboratories and hybrid operating rooms to support such procedures. As competition between manufacturers increases, product development is becoming quicker, with companies introducing next-generation drug-eluting stents, bioresorbable scaffolds, and imaging devices. This incessant flow of technological advancements is not only broadening the horizons of interventional cardiology but also speeding up its implementation in South Korea's healthcare centers. In 2025, Siemens Healthineers Korea has entered a strategic memorandum of understanding (MOU) with Phantomics, a Korean expert in cardiac imaging AI, to collaboratively promote the clinical implementation of AI-driven cardiac MRI analysis.
Government Support, Sophisticated Healthcare Infrastructure, and Insurance Coverage
South Korea's strong healthcare infrastructure and proactive government support are positively influencing the market. The nation has invested heavily in enhancing its healthcare system, with a focus on specialized cardiology care units and integration of medical technology. Government programs of early diagnosis and preventive cardiology are facilitating the identification of patients earlier in the course of the disease, resulting in increased numbers of interventional procedures. Moreover, positive reimbursement policies and universal healthcare coverage have lowered out-of-pocket costs for patients receiving interventional procedures. This has made them more accessible and affordable, prompting more individuals to choose advanced cardiac interventions. The regulatory climate in South Korea is also conducive to medical device development, facilitating quicker approval and implementation of new technology. In addition, an abundance of skilled interventional cardiologists and ongoing programs for medical training provide assurance that the healthcare workforce is equipped to utilize the most advanced devices.
